Before the DO's start their review you may want to add a little black paint to those TD screws OPTIONAL Level two certification (if applicable): Clips shall be attached with slotted type, flat or dome top style screws, and be black (two per clip). Also with fabric gloves the hand plates must be stitched directly to gloves OPTIONAL Level two certification (if applicable): If silk or satin gloves are worn, the hand plates have the correct visible stitching with a 5 point/star pattern, equally spread out with 2 on each side and 1 in the middle front, double stitched with 2 holes at each point and sewn to the glove at each one using black thread.
